Overview

UT TYLER UNIVERSITY ACADEMY AT PALESTINE is a public other serving grades 0–12 in PALESTINE, Texas. The school enrolls 263 students. It is part of the UT TYLER UNIVERSITY ACADEMY district. The school operates as a charter school.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
